Gizmo announced brand new Call In numbers for people who want local phone numbers in France, Spain or the United Kingdom.

Remember Call In?

It's a great service that gives you a traditional, local phone number for your Gizmo softphone so anyone can reach you using your home area code, no matter where you happen to be. Your friends and contacts will never have to memorize a new number, which gives them no excuse not stay in touch even if you're traveling!

Best of all, there are no additional charges to receive their calls, and of course it's far cheaper for the people who call you.

Gizmo Project wouldn't be where it is today without their commitment to continuously improving the software. Here are some of their favorite new advancements:

Resolved bug with WiFi network-switching and network disconnection (Windows)
Contact Grouping – Neatly organize your Contacts with user-definable categories
Improved IM – Support for chat styles
Mac client now compiled for native performance on PowerPC and Intel chipsets (Mac)
Localizations completed for French, Spanish, German, Japanese, and Chinese languages (Mac)
